Garlic String/Green Beans (Fit for Life)
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 30 Minutes
Ready In: 40 Minutes
Servings: 4
My family has been using this recipe since the 80's. These are great with steak or chicken. Also great if you are on a low calorie diet.
Ingredients:
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 teaspoon garlic, minced
4 cups fresh string beans or 4 cups frozen string beans
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me or 1 teaspoon fresh thyme
1/2 teaspoon sea salt
fresh ground pepper (about a tsp)
2 cups water
1 vegetable bouillon cube
1 dash fresh lemon juice
Directions:
1. In large heavy saucepan, heat oil.
2. Add garlic and beans, and saute over high heat to sear beans, stirring frequently so they do not burn.
3. Add thyme, sea salt, and pepper to taste.
4. Add water and bouillon.
5. Bring to boil, cover tightly, reduce heat to medium-low, and simmer for 20-30 minutes or until beans are tender when pierced with tip of sharp knife.
6. Add more water, if necessary.
7. Frozen beans will take only half the time.
8. Add squeeze of lemon juice and toss well.
9. Original recipe states it serves 2 but it easily will serve four as a side dish.
